AI code review that runs your code
Ito is an innovative AI-powered code review tool designed to enhance the quality and reliability of software development. Unlike traditional static analysis tools, Ito operates by spinning up ephemeral environments for each pull request, running the application in real-world conditions to validate impacted workflows. It then provides detailed runtime evidence, pinpointing exactly what broke, where it happened, and why it matters, offering developers a much clearer understanding of issues before merging. This approach helps teams catch bugs that static analysis often misses, reducing the risk of bugs reaching production. Ito is ideal for development teams seeking a more dynamic, accurate, and efficient code review process that combines AI insights with real execution data, ultimately leading to faster debugging and more robust releases.

Figma for Claude Code
Inspector reimagines the design-to-code workflow by integrating visual editing directly with AI-powered code generation. Designed for developers, designers, and product teams, it allows users to click on UI elements within a design interface, make visual adjustments, and have those changes automatically reflected in the underlying codebase. The tool connects seamlessly with popular AI agents like Claude Code, Codex, and Cursor, streamlining the often tedious handoff process between design and development. Its unique approach eliminates the need for manual code edits or back-and-forth communication, enabling rapid prototyping and iteration. By bridging the gap between visual design and code, Inspector enhances productivity and fosters a more collaborative workflow, making it ideal for teams seeking to accelerate their development cycles with AI-powered precision.
